什麼是硬體驅動程式,為什麼它們會引起很多問題?

2021-10-01 16:21:01 字數 938 閱讀 9357

如果您遇到了計算機故障,則可能是硬體驅動程式造成的。 這些是計算機作業系統用來與其硬體對話的軟體。 從windows到android的每個作業系統都使用硬體驅動程式。

驅動程式就像計算機的翻譯器

從根本上講,兩個主要元件構成一台計算機-軟體和硬體。 軟體是您的作業系統(os)以及已安裝在其上的所有程式和應用程式。 主機板,ram,滑鼠,鍵盤,印表機以及連線到計算機的其他任何物理裝置組成了硬體。

沒有任何幫助,該軟體將不會與您的硬體對話,反之亦然。 硬體驅動程式是一些軟體,可以教您的os,程式和應用程式如何與裝置一起使用。 想象一下,您的作業系統說英語,而硬體說德語。 然後,硬體驅動程式是語言直譯器,將英語轉換為德語,然後再次轉換為德語。

製造商製造驅動; 軟體開發人員使用它們

由於驅動程式處理硬體翻譯,您可能會認為這意味著製造硬體的製造商會製造驅動程式。 有時候是這樣; 例如,製造商可能會製造您的圖形驅動程式。 但這並非總是如此。

microsoft(和某些製造商)提供任何人都可以使用的通用驅動程式。 這些驅動程式可節省成本,並在整個裝置上實現效能一致性。 跳過驅動程式建立過程,使製造商可以將其硬體調整為符合公司需求的,經過全面測試的著名驅動程式。 例如,您的滑鼠,鍵盤和usb驅動器可能使

用microsoft製造的通用驅動程式。

某些裝置可以使用通用驅動程式,但在特定於裝置的驅動程式下可能會表現更好。 例如,您的計算機的圖形卡(gpu)可以使用通用驅動程式將您的桌面輸出到顯示器,但是為了獲得最佳3d遊戲效能,它需要其製造商nvidia,amd或intel的驅動程式。

無論由誰來製作驅動程式,軟體開發人員都可以利用和使用它們。 您的文字編輯器或文字處理器會呼叫列印驅動程式來與印表機一起使用,並呼叫圖形驅動程式來顯示文字。 沒有這些驅動程式,您的程式將不知道如何與印表機或顯示器對話以完成諸如列印和更改字型大小之類的基本功能。 硬體驅動程式可以使軟體開發人員有所收穫。 他們無需學習硬體語言的來龍去脈即可使用硬體。

什麼是驅動程式

驅動程式即新增到作業系統中的一小塊 其中包含有關 硬體裝置的 資訊。有了此資訊,計算機就可以與裝置進行通訊。驅動程式是硬體廠商根據作業系統編寫的配置檔案,可以說沒有驅動程式,計算機中的硬體就無法工作。作業系統不同,硬體的驅動程式也不同,各個硬體廠商為了保證硬體的相容性及增強硬體的功能會不斷地公升級驅...

什麼是簽名的驅動程式?

簽名的驅動程式是一種包含數字簽名的裝置驅動程式。數字簽名是一種電子安全性標記,它可以指明軟體的發行者,以及是否有人已更改驅動程式包的原始內容。如果驅動程式已由使用證書頒發機構驗證其身份的發行者簽名,則您可以確信驅動程式實際來自該發布者並且沒有被更改。如果驅動程式沒有簽名,未由使用證書頒發機構驗證其身...

驅動程式是什麼

我目前所在的部門叫做驅動組,而做的東西本質上不是驅動程式來的.所在研發部門把串列埠通訊程式叫作驅動程式,我覺得不妥的,今天和同事們討論了一下.很多同事對驅動程式的概念感到模糊。其實公司裡的串列埠通訊程式只是乙個操作串列埠的應用程式,而驅動程式是由作業系統管理的,由作業系統呼叫的,有同事問我,什麼是應...